Transaction 871c66b265f232b3228cb8eb58de627fdb9518d659077e343ece4e0b6f7fae62
1 Input
1 Output
-
871c66b265f232b3228cb8eb58de627fdb9518d659077e343ece4e0b6f7fae62:0
- value
- 1151985
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64218c009184702126939d317865be33754ed4a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A8Sm4ZVVR1M7CcJarMzAuNpMShpRpcouA